Does ESG Compliance Drive Commercial Banks Stock Returns? Evidence from the South African Market
Purpose: The study examined the effect of environmental, social and governance (ESG) on the commercial bank returns in South Africa. Design/Methodology/Approach: The study made use of a cross sectional panel model for the sample period 2015-2024.

Price Premiums for Single‐Name and Compound‐Name Geographical Indications in Swiss Cheese Trade
ABSTRACT Geographical indications (GIs) have become increasingly important in agri‐food markets, especially in Europe. For Swiss cheese imports and exports, we analyze whether GIs are associated with higher trade prices. We find that price premiums can be obtained for both exports and imports. However, this is only the case for cheeses with single name
